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 4023 25811 4436834237 455546359
685246604 957777687 573006609
685246604 957777687 573006609
033296 455344451 7733237101 6985
All about undefined
Interested in learning more?
685246604 957777687 573006609
033296 455344451 7733237101 6985
See more
14735 61642 334863
35756121 61469 077 42870572
See more
27815690224 38
782874 7515 0223558603
See more